Which correctly demonstrates how an anatomist and a physiologist might describe the following functions of the body?
VikaD [51]

A) Anatomist studies the structure of temperature sensors in the body.

Physiologist studies how the body detects dropping body temperature.

An anatomist studies WHAT the structures are of humans (and other living organisms). Anatomy can be macroscopic or microscopic and discusses the way the parts (from minute to big) interact to form a functional unit. The study of anatomy is often paired with the study of physiology, but the two are distinct from each other. Physiology covers HOW and WHY the parts function. A physiologist specializes in the study of living organisms’ functions, activities and organic processes.
